The Sports Channel in Israel has secured the exclusive broadcasting rights for EuroLeague Basketball for an additional six years, through the 2030-31 season.

NEW YORK (Reuters) - Euroleague CEO Paulius Motiejunas said he wants to preserve the spirit of European basketball as his organisation faces potential competition from the ultra-powerful NBA.
"The Board discussed the announced proposals for the creation of a new European league, viewing such a move as a threat to the long-standing traditions of European basketball," the Euroleague said ...
